February 2026 in “ACS Nano” The study presents the development of the TLMG hydrogel, a biointerface platform that forms in situ and adheres robustly to irregular skin wounds, offering enhanced mechanical properties and real-time signal monitoring for advanced wound management. By integrating tea polyphenols/lignin microspheres, the hydrogel combines bioelectronic and bioactive interfaces, achieving strong adhesion (200 kPa), high ionic conductivity (0.27 mS cm–1), and mechanical stability. Tested in complex animal models and human trials, the TLMG platform demonstrated intelligent wound management, dynamic signal monitoring, and improved wound healing through immunomodulatory mechanisms, highlighting its potential for wearable healthcare systems.
